Operations Update re Orchid Well (Licence P.1556 Block 29/1c)
Trapoil (AIM: TRAP), the independent oil and gas exploration and appraisal company focused on the UK Continental Shelf ("UKCS") region of the North Sea, has been advised by Summit Petroleum Limited ("Summit") that the 12 ¼" hole section of the Orchid well bore has been re-drilled as a mechanical side-track.
The partners in exploration licence P.1556 are Summit (45 per cent., operator), Valiant Exploration Limited (30 per cent.), Atlantic Petroleum UK Limited (10 per cent.) and Trapoil (15 per cent., of which 5 per cent. is carried and 10 per cent. is a paying interest).
A further update on the Orchid well which is being drilled under a turnkey arrangement, at no additional cost to Trapoil, will be provided after well operations have been completed.
Orchid marks the start of Trapoil's 2012 exploration programme which it is currently intended will include the drilling of up to a total of seven wells targeting total best estimate net risked prospective resources of approximately 14.3mmboe (unaudited estimate by Trapoil's management). Trapoil is being carried for the majority of these wells and anticipates contributing funds to only one other well in this planned drilling programme.

·; The Trapoil group was created in 2008 by a team of experienced industry executives with a broad range of oil and gas technical, operational and financial expertise and professional skills.
·; Trapoil has developed long term relationships with key oil industry partners, notably Suncor Energy Incorporated, Norwegian Energy Company ASA and Challenger Minerals (North Sea) Limited, and major suppliers and consultants including CGGVeritas Services (UK) Limited ("CGGVeritas"), Applied Drilling Technology International and Exploration Geosciences Limited.
·; The Company utilises a research-led, knowledge-based approach to identify and deliver promising exploration and appraisal opportunities, and to this end has secured extensive long term access to CGGVeritas' state of the art 3D seismic database over the majority of the Central North Sea area on negotiated terms. CGGVeritas is a leading pure-play geophysical services and equipment provider. Access to such 3D seismic data serves to strengthen the group's ability to create opportunities on both open and held acreage in the UKCS.
